Ed
ontem
A pergunta parece estar relacionada à análise de um diagrama de estados e como isso se traduz em um algoritmo. Para responder corretamente, precisamos entender as estruturas de controle que podem ser inferidas a partir do diagrama. Vamos analisar as alternativas: 1. "O algoritmo possui uma estrutura de seleção com a if-then-else dentro do qual há outra estrutura tipo if-then-else." - Isso sugere uma estrutura de decisão aninhada, que pode ser comum, mas não necessariamente reflete um comportamento de repetição. 2. "O algoritmo tipo possui uma estrutura de repetição while dentro dele." - Isso indica que o algoritmo tem um loop, mas não menciona estruturas de seleção. 3. "O algoritmo possui uma estrutura de seleção tipo do-while, dentro do qual há uma estrutura de repetição tipo for." - Isso sugere um loop que garante que o bloco de código seja executado pelo menos uma vez, mas a combinação de estruturas pode não ser a mais comum. 4. "O algoritmo possui uma estrutura de seleção tipo while, dentro do qual há uma estrutura de seleção tipo if-then-else e dentro de um de seus ramos há uma estrutura de repetição tipo do-while." - Essa opção combina uma estrutura de repetição com uma estrutura de seleção, o que pode ser uma representação válida dependendo do diagrama. 5. "O algoritmo possui uma estrutura de seleção tipo while, dentro do qual há uma estrutura de repetição tipo for e dentro dele há uma estrutura de seleção tipo if-then dentro dele outra estrutura de seleção." - Essa opção é complexa e sugere múltiplas camadas de controle, o que pode ser uma representação válida, mas é mais complicada. Dado que a pergunta não fornece o diagrama de estados, a melhor escolha é aquela que combina estruturas de repetição e seleção de forma lógica e que é comum em algoritmos. A alternativa que parece mais equilibrada e que reflete uma estrutura de controle típica em algoritmos é a 4: "O algoritmo possui uma estrutura de seleção tipo while, dentro do qual há uma estrutura de seleção tipo if-then-else e dentro de um de seus ramos há uma estrutura de repetição tipo do-while." Portanto, a resposta correta é a 4.